Now that little Sadie has arrived and we're adjusting to the new pleasures and pressures of parenthood, it's about time to really plan our wedding.  We're getting married in a beautiful barn that serves as an event center. There's a fireplace, a large stage, twinkle lights along the upper level and candles on the beams. 

In order to keep with the rustic feel that we love about the venue, I've been scouring the Internet for images that represents simplicity, class and rustic charm. I found a lot of these images on Pintrest and hope you enjoy them as well.


 I really enjoy the use of canning jars, crisp white linens and burlap runners.

I think this is a gorgeous center piece. If our budget allowed, I would consider using a wine bottle with our photo and use that to label the tables. A treat for all of our guests, and a cute way to direct people to where they will be sitting.


 I wish these flowers were going to be in season for our wedding. I really want twigs with flowers to be placed on the mantle of the fireplace and near the bar.



 I love the mix and matched jars with ribbon detail.

 I think I'm going to steal this idea. I love buntings. This one looks like it was made with scrap booking paper and twine.

 I love this use of tulle. I'm considering doing something like this for the stage area. I also love the use of chalkboards to explain desserts.

 And fresh rosemary lining the chairs.



Sprigs of lavender on tiny clothes pins to let people know what table they are assigned to.

Now I just need to ensure the dresses for myself and the bridesmaids fit this style of wedding and I need to settle on an idea so that we can begin collecting and creating what we need.
